Output 8e5907c21da3f32bb6d3752d85d5a8bedb7ececb9950b3c80fb0145098d716dd:28

value
572659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9af8b058a60326c3207417465b7765d74d834e36 OP_EQUALVERIFY OP_CHECKSIG
address
1F8QykHXgttydesXUVYE814EZVHcWp4NiE
transaction
8e5907c21da3f32bb6d3752d85d5a8bedb7ececb9950b3c80fb0145098d716dd
spent
true